Winning CASH5 Lottery Ticket Sold In Bridgeport

The lucky ticket was purchased in Bridgeport, according to the Connecticut Lottery.

BRIDGEPORT, CT — An unnamed Fairfield resident is $$55,593 richer this week after claiming a winning lottery ticket purchased in Bridgeport, the Connecticut Lottery announced.

On Friday, the person claimed a winning CASH5 ticket that was bought at the Stop & Shop at 4531 Main St. in Bridgeport.

The Connecticut Lottery publishes partial winner information as public record, according to officials.

CASH5 is a pari-mutuel game, which costs $1 per wager. Top prize is $100,000.

Overall odds of winning vary, but the odds of matching all five numbers for a top prize are 1 in 324,632.
